New Contemporaries Lola Paprocka -Talk

As part of the Photography Research Group’s visiting speaker programme for 2016/17, the New Contemporaries talk series provides a platform for the work and ideas of a new generation of young, emerging photographers, curators and publishers in the UK. The talks series is curated by Plymouth alumni Robert Darch, who graduated from our MFA Photography programme earlier this year and who is part of this new generation. As Robert says: ‘New Contemporaries brings together five prominent speakers who are all actively engaged with the photographic medium in varying contexts. All have well defined photographic practices, but collectively they also represent a tendency in contemporary photography to work in different ways across genres and disciplines, which may involve them in aspects of publishing, curating and writing. We find ourselves in an increasingly connected world and although there is an emphasis on new technologies and social media as platforms for showcasing work, there is still a strong relationship between this and analogue processes in the making and curating of photography, and in publishing and self-publishing.’
